Temporary Use Application

  • Type
  • SEC. 15-9. The application for the permit shall be filed not less than thirty (30) days before the first performance and shall contain the following information.

    Please submit a detailed explanation of your temporary use/public entertainment.

    Please state if outside speakers will or will not be utilized (this includes amplified music live and/or DJ, master of ceremonies, etc.) Please state in your letter if you are not providing food sales/service, please state so in your explanation. If the event is sponsored by a non-profit organization, please provide a copy of your non-profit tax exempt certification.

    Please submit an accurate site plan showing location of event along with ingress and egress and fire exit plan. For tents over 400 square foot, that have sides or will be open after dark - a detailed layout of the tent with the emergency lights, exit lights, exit doors and fixtures indicated shall be required.

    Please mark the location of any and all speaker and the direction they face. If outdoor speakers are to be used, show the location and the direction of sound (speakers shall face away from residential neighborhoods).

    With each public entertainment permit, a liability, fire and comprehensive insurance policy shall be provided reflecting the City of Grapevine as an additional insured party for an adequate and reasonable amount of insurance as determined by the City Manager, in an amount not less than three hundred thousand dollars ($300,000.00) per occurrence.

    An appropriate permit from the Health Department shall be required for any food service and/or sales.

    Tents - a tent permit and inspections are required from both the Building Inspection Department (817- 410-3165) and Fire Department (817-410-4400). The tent shall be installed by a registered contractor and a flame spread certificate shall be submitted.

    Fencing - Any fences that cross fire lanes shall be plastic construction fencing. The fencing shall be such that it can be moved by one person in the event of an emergency.

  • Temporary outside display and sales of merchandise, and food service may be permitted on one occasion in any quarter of a calendar year for a period not to exceed 14 consecutive days, subject to the following conditions:

    (a) A site plan must be submitted for approval by the Development Services Director designating the area for outside display, sales and/or food service. Show location of any outdoor speaker and the direction of sound (speakers shall face away from residential neighborhoods).

    (b) The merchandise to be displayed or sold must be clearly related or incidental to the current Certificate of Occupancy (and must be taken out by the Certificate of Occupancy holder) at the site. Itinerant vendors shall not be permitted.

    (c) Items for outside display within the festival area are to be approved by the City of Grapevine Festival Committee.

    (d) A minimum four feet of clear sidewalk width shall be maintained at all times and at no time shall required egress from the building be obstructed.

    (e) Use of required parking areas for temporary outside display and sales shall not negatively impact the ability to provide adequate parking on the subject site nor shall it create a burden on surrounding properties or encourage parking within the right-of-way. Approval for use of required parking areas shall be at the discretion of the Development Services Director.

    (f) An appropriate permit from the Health Department shall be required for any food sales/service. See attached application.

    (g) Tents - a tent permit is required from the Building Inspection Department. The tent shall be installed by a registered contractor and a flame spread certificate shall be submitted. Please call 817-410-3165 for details.

    For tents over 400 square feet, that have sides or will be open after dark - a detailed layout of the tent with the emergency lights, exit lights, exit doors and fixtures indicated shall be required.

    Fencing - Any fences that cross fire lanes shall be plastic construction fencing. The fencing shall be such that it can be moved by one person in the event of an emergency.

    (h) Please provide a letter detailing the temporary use. Please note if outside speakers will or will not be utilized (this includes amplified music live and/or DJ, master of ceremonies, etc.) Please state in your letter if you are not providing food sales/service.

    (i) Application must be received ten (10) days before the start of the event.

Texas Sales Tax

section

  • Texas Sales Tax is charged and collected on sales within the State and City of Grapevine, Texas of “taxable items.” Taxable items include both tangible personal property, specified services. If you are in a business that will be selling “taxable items” within the City of Grapevine, Texas you will be required to collect State and Local Sales Tax in the amount of 8.25%.

    A “Seller or Retailer” means a person engaged in the business of making sales of “taxable items”, the receipts from which are included in the measure of sales or use tax.

    The term, “place of business” includes any location at which three or more orders are received by the “Seller or Retailer in a calendar year. If an order is received at the place of business of a retailer in Texas, but delivery or shipment is made from a location within the state other than the retailer’s place of business. State and local sales tax is due and is allocated to the city where the order was received.
